Can a bushing be removed from a car?

With the suspension lowered, you can remove the assembly that holds the suspension bushing. There will be at least one on each side. To remove the assembly, fit a socket on the outside and an open end wrench on the inside of the center bolt.

How to install rear suspension bushing in Subaru?

Advice: If you are doing the entire rear end, install the trailing arm LAST or at least place all the control arms in place FIRST!!!! You will need the control arms in place to help line up the bolt holes for the trailing arm mounting plate. I tried to install the trailing arm mounting plate with all control arms disconnected.

What to use to clean rear suspension bushing?

Medium Grit sand paper makes cleaning the bore of the control arms much easier. Wirewheel drill attachment to clean the bolt threads. Good Anti-Seize compound to coat the bolt shafts and threads. Good mechanics gloves with rubber backing to protect the top of your hands.
